Two very different men:

Barjesus was a false prophet and a magician.

Any power he had came from demons.

Sergius Paulus was a prudent man,

deputy of that country.

Page 6: Acts 13b  trust god enough to live by his word

6

Sergius Paulus wanted to hear the Word of God.

Page 7: Acts 13b  trust god enough to live by his word

7

8 But Elymas the sorcerer (for so is his name by

interpretation) withstood them, seeking to turn

away the deputy from the faith.

He wasn't wise, but he was sly.

He knew that if the deputy believed the True

God, he would get rid of his pet sorcerer.
